Neck was reset. New Brazilian rosewood fret board installed.
This is fairly rare bird. This is not the full sized H162 that is for sale everywhere, but a ukulele sized child size
guitar. In the early sixties Harmony made a small number of these with a properly sized rosewood bridge. The more
common versions have a sloppy looking, giant bridge that looks all out of place. So this is nice looking.
It now plays nice, too, with excellent intonation.
